How Does Credit Card Wells Fargo Payment Work?

At its core, the Credit Card Wells Fargo Payment system enables cardholders to make purchases, pay bills, and track spending through secure digital channels. Users access their card via mobile apps or web platforms, completing transactions with encryption and real-time authorization. The payment infrastructure supports contactless choices, online bill pay, and automatic payment scheduling—features that reduce friction and build confidence in daily use.
